'Feeling Good... Keeping Safe' - Doorstep Crime Awareness

This project was originally devised by community members in partnership with Kirklees Victim Support and the Lawrence Batley Theatre.

Figment has further developed the interactive element of the programme and increased its learning capacity. Aimed at older adults, school pupils and the wider community, the project features a series of short scenarios and Forum Theatre sessions based around the story of the Three Little Pigs.

Audiences are then invited to explore strategies for dealing with doorstep crime and test the validity of their ideas in a safe and entertaining environment.

Target group KS3/4 pupils and older adults over 60
Format 60 - 90 minutes performances and Forum session in community venues and schools
Benefits Adapts to suit a variety of venues and groups
Targets localised issues in a community setting
Empowers through contribution and sharing experience
Increases relevancy via audience input
Highlights the risks of bogus callers and rogue callers
Inspires social change and behaviours
Allows for rehearsal of real situations in a safe environment
Develops skills and procedures for tackling doorstep callers
Raises awareness of the issues without scaremongering
